印度首都空气污染水平达到安全限值的50倍,导致空气窒息

(SeaPRwire) - 新德里——由于空气污染飙升至本季最严重水平,印度首都的当局周一关闭了学校,暂停了施工,并禁止非必要的卡车进入城市。 新德里居民醒来时,发现浓厚的、有毒的烟雾笼罩着这座约3300万人口的城市,空气质量越来越恶劣。据印度主要的环保机构SAFAR称,空气中的细颗粒物含量进一步上升至严重级别,这些细颗粒物可以深入肺部。 致命的雾霾覆盖了首都的纪念碑和高层建筑,能见度极低,航空公司警告航班延误。 在城市的几个地区,污染水平比世界卫生组织推荐的安全限值高出50多倍。预测显示,空气质量恶劣的情况将持续到本周。 印度北部的空气污染每年都在加剧,尤其是在冬季,因为农民在农业地区焚烧农作物残渣。焚烧与较低的温度相吻合,这使得烟雾滞留在空气中。然后,烟雾被吹进城市,汽车尾气加剧了污染。 工业排放和燃煤发电也与污染有关,近几周污染情况一直在加剧。 从周一,当局开始执行分级响应行动计划(GRAP)的第四阶段(GRAP 4),该计划根据空气污染的严重程度制定。该计划的早期阶段已经实施,第四阶段包括更严格的限制措施。 除10年级和12年级外,所有年级的课程都将在线进行,除运送必需品的卡车外,所有卡车都不得进入城市。一些老旧的、耗油的柴油车已被禁止进入城市,所有建筑活动都已暂停。当局还敦促儿童、老年人和患有慢性疾病或呼吸系统疾病的人尽量避免外出。 周末,邻近的北方邦的农民焚烧了他们的田地,释放出大量灰烟,风可能将这些烟雾带到了新德里和其他附近地区。尽管空气有毒,但首都的许多人仍在继续他们的日常活动,包括在城市深受欢迎的洛迪花园。 “每个人都喉咙痛,”51岁的新德里店主桑杰·戈尔说。“他们应该禁止焚烧农作物残渣……到处都是烟雾。” 首都不断恶化的空气质量也引发了居民在社交媒体上的愤怒。许多人抱怨头痛和咳嗽,形容这座城市是“世界末日”和“毒气室”。其他人则敦促官员彻底解决这场公共卫生危机。几项研究估计,每年有超过一百万印度人死于与污染相关的疾病。 当局已经采取了措施,有时还部署了洒水车和除霾枪来试图控制雾霾。但批评人士表示,需要一个长期的解决方案,从根本上减少污染本身,而不是采取一些旨在减轻污染影响的措施。本文由第三方内容提供商提供。SeaPRwire (https://www.seaprwire.com/)对此不作任何保证或陈述。 分类: 头条新闻,日常新闻 SeaPRwire为公司和机构提供全球新闻稿发布,覆盖超过6,500个媒体库、86,000名编辑和记者,以及350万以上终端桌面和手机App。SeaPRwire支持英、日、德、韩、法、俄、印尼、马来、越南、中文等多种语言新闻稿发布。

World’s First Successful Trial of Quantum Tokens Created Using Quantum Technology

TOKYO, Nov 18, 2024 - (JCN Newswire via SeaPRwire.com) - NEC Corporation (NEC; TSE: 6701) today announced a successful trial of tokens(1) created using quantum technology (quantum tokens) in cooperation with Tokyo-based Mitsui & Co., Ltd. (Mitsui) and U.S.-based Quantinuum.Mitsui and Quantinuum, which is engaged in the global rollout of quantum computing, have been working to develop practical unforgeable quantum tokens based on properties of quantum physics that are patented by Quantinuum. Until now, the principle behind quantum tokens had been proven in theory, but this time, using a quantum key distribution (QKD)(2) system for quantum cryptography communications(3) provided by NEC and 10km of optical fiber cable, the world's first demonstration experiment has been conducted to issue and redeem quantum tokens in an environment assumed for commercial use, and it was confirmed that tokens can be issued and redeemed as theoretically predicted.Unlike the tokens used in conventional communications technology, quantum tokens cannot be forged and can be redeemed instantly. Thanks to these characteristics, it will be possible to use them for a variety of purposes, including data restoration and certification, primarily for financial sector applications, such as high-speed transactions and commodity trading. The quantum cryptographic communication technology used in the trial is expected to be used in future infrastructure development as a communication method that cannot be decrypted by quantum computers, and quantum tokens can be used on this infrastructure. Based on the results of this trial, NEC will continue to work towards the social implementation of quantum cryptography technology.The equipment provided by NEC was partially supported by "Research and Development for the Construction of a Global Quantum Cryptographic Communication Network (JPJ008957)" project, which is part of the results from Japan’s Ministry of Internal Affairs and Communications’ (MIC) "R&D of ICT Priority Technology Project" (JPMI00316) and Japan’s Cabinet Office’s "Photonics and Quantum Technology for Society 5.0" project under the Cross-ministerial Strategic Innovation Promotion Program (SIP).(1) Token: A digital certificate indicating certain rights and values, such as digital assets, user information, and access rights.(2) Quantum key distribution (QKD) systems use quantum mechanics to share random secret keys between two communicating parties in order to guarantee secure communication, and then encrypt and decrypt information based on those keys. (Patented (as of November 18, 2024))(3 )Quantum cryptographic communication: Various companies are working to develop communications technologies that employ quantum properties to make eavesdropping physically impossible. A.M.AUTONOMY Showcases MAP-TORCH for 3D Construction Digitalization at KINTEX

Seoul, Korea – November 18, 2024 – (SeaPRwire) – A.M.AUTONOMY will showcase its solution, ‘MAP-TORCH’, which digitizes construction sites into three dimensions, at the Smart Construction Expo held in November 2024 at KINTEX, South Korea. A key aspect of smart construction is the real-time 3D digitalization of construction sites. By rapidly digitalizing sites into 3D, it becomes possible to detect physical changes within the space. This data can also be integrated with BIM (Building Information Modeling) to analyze progress rates or estimate material quantities. Furthermore, construction sites can be recorded and monitored over time in 3D rather than relying on 2D images. A.M.AUTONOMY’s MAP-TORCH is a device capable of real-time 3D mapping for such construction sites. MAP-TORCH also includes an extended version, MAP-TORCH X, which integrates sensors for detecting hazardous gases and radiation. This solution, combined with MagoWorks for remote monitoring, provides enhanced functionality. Currently, MAP-TORCH X is undergoing usability tests in collaboration with the Korea Atomic Energy Research Institute. By integrating a radiation detector into MAP-TORCH, it enables the acquisition of 3D radiation distribution data in facilities such as nuclear power plants. In environments like nuclear facilities, where GPS signals are often disrupted and irregular location data is required, drones frequently face challenges in conducting surveys. However, MAP-TORCH can conduct surveys without relying on GPS, significantly aiding in accident prevention in the nuclear industry. MAP-TORCH X received considerable acclaim in 2023 from various nuclear-related organizations and researchers worldwide at the International Atomic Energy Agency (IAEA). A.M.AUTONOMY is expanding its solutions from nuclear facilities to construction sites, aiming to prevent safety accidents caused by hazardous gases in confined spaces. 沙丘:预言中你需要了解的关于贝尼·格塞里特的一切

(SeaPRwire) - 警告:本文包含《沙丘:预言》第一集的剧透。 HBO的新剧《沙丘:预言》系列故事设定在保罗·阿特雷德斯出生并崛起成为预言中的弥赛亚利桑-阿尔-盖布之前一万年,它记述了贝尼·格塞里特女修会从一个为有天赋的年轻女性提供教育的初级学校发展成为在《沙丘》故事开篇时操纵帝国政府的拥有超能力的神秘女修会的早期演变过程。 《沙丘:预言》改编自2012年出版的《沙丘姐妹会》,这是弗兰克·赫伯特之子布莱恩·赫伯特和凯文·J·安德森在弗兰克去世后共同创作的《沙丘大学校》前传三部曲中的第一部。节目制作人艾莉森·沙普克的这部剧集以哈肯宁姐妹瓦莉娅和图拉为中心(成年后分别由艾米丽·沃森和奥利维亚·威廉姆斯饰演,童年时期则由杰西卡·巴登和艾玛·卡宁饰演)。她们出生在大机器战争(在《沙丘》宇宙中被称为“但丁之战”)结束大约60年后——这场战争是宇宙中最后自由的人类发起的对所有机器技术的清洗运动——是弗拉基米尔·哈肯宁男爵、他的侄子费德-劳萨和野兽拉班以及保罗的母亲杰西卡和保罗本人的远祖。 正如帝国的历史书所记载的那样,阿特雷德家族的先祖沃里安·阿特雷德领导人类在战争的最后阶段战胜了机器,而瓦莉娅和图拉的曾祖父阿布拉德·哈肯宁则临阵脱逃,被贴上了懦夫的标签。这导致哈肯宁家族蒙羞并被流放到荒凉的兰基维尔星球。然而,瓦莉娅认为阿特雷德家族编写的历史充满了谎言,并且在年轻时就决心通过获得贝尼·格塞里特的权力来颠覆现状。 女修会内部的分裂 当我们在《预言》的首集中看到年轻的姐妹瓦莉娅和图拉时,瓦莉娅正被培养成贝尼·格塞里特有史以来第一任女修道院院长拉奎拉·贝尔托-阿尼鲁尔(凯西·泰森饰)的继承人,取代拉奎拉自己的孙女多罗泰娅修女(卡米拉·比普特饰)。拉奎拉在战争中是一位英雄,她最初创立了这个组织,目的是训练其成员成为“真理者”,那些能够运用真理感知能力并被分配到各个大贵族家族以帮助他们辨别真伪的人。 然而,正如年长的瓦莉娅在画外音中解释的那样,当时贝尼·格塞里特内部存在争议,争议的焦点在于拉奎拉希望创建一个秘密的生育计划,女修会可以使用这个计划来促进正确的王室联姻,并培养贝尼·格塞里特可以控制的统治者。虽然瓦莉娅与拉奎拉的想法一致,但瓦莉娅称之为“狂热分子”的多罗泰娅认为这个生育计划是异端邪说,并认为该组织的目的是引导帝国,而不是统治它。(这就是贝尼·格塞里特一万年后仍在使用的生育计划,他们试图实现的目标是产生被称为“库萨克”的被选中者,这是一个无与伦比的贝尼·格塞里特男性,能够接触到他所有祖先的记忆,并看到所有可能的未来。) 拉奎拉在临终之际召见瓦莉娅来到她身边,并转述了一个预言,这使得瓦莉娅更加坚定了自己的信念。“红色的尘土。它即将到来。泰坦-阿拉法尔,”她说,用的是指暴君带来的圣裁审判的词语。“你将是那个看到燃烧的真相并知晓的人。” 当多罗泰娅试图违背祖母的遗言销毁生育指数时,瓦莉娅运用了一种她一直在培养的新能力——“声音”——这种能力能让使用者以一种能够让另一个人服从他们所说的一切的方式说话——强迫多罗泰娅用自己的刀自杀。 女修道院院长瓦莉娅·哈肯宁 作为“声音”的发明者和女修道院院长拉奎拉的弟子,瓦莉娅是贝尼·格塞里特最高职位理所当然的继承人,一旦多罗泰娅离开后。30年后,很明显她已经极大地增强了该组织对帝国的控制。 瓦莉娅策划让皇帝贾维科·科里诺(马克·斯特朗饰)的女儿、帝国王位的继承人伊内兹公主(莎拉-索菲·布苏尼纳饰)在与里奇斯家族9岁的继承人普鲁维特·里奇斯(查理·霍德森-普莱尔饰)包办婚姻后,来学习成为一名修女,她即将实现自己的目标:安排贝尼·格塞里特家族中的一员统治帝国,成为帝国有史以来的第一位女皇。也就是说,直到普鲁维特——以及科里诺家族的真理者卡莎修女(池珍饰)——死于德斯蒙德·哈特(饰)之手。德斯蒙德是科里诺皇帝军队中一名先前被认为已经死亡的士兵,他从在沙漠星球阿拉基斯服役归来,声称自己获得了“强大的力量”,这向瓦莉娅发出了信号,表明拉奎拉所说的“燃烧的真相”终于显露出来。 “德斯蒙德与引发本剧的预言有关,”沙普克告诉《时代》杂志。“他确实是本剧的一个谜。是谁赋予了他力量,或者是什么赋予了他力量,这是一个中心谜团,我们的姐妹们必须找出答案。” 《沙丘:预言》其余五集将于每周日美国东部时间晚上9点在HBO播出,同时也在Max平台上线。本文由第三方内容提供商提供。SeaPRwire (https://www.seaprwire.com/)对此不作任何保证或陈述。 分类: 头条新闻,日常新闻 SeaPRwire为公司和机构提供全球新闻稿发布,覆盖超过6,500个媒体库、86,000名编辑和记者,以及350万以上终端桌面和手机App。SeaPRwire支持英、日、德、韩、法、俄、印尼、马来、越南、中文等多种语言新闻稿发布。

特朗普国防部长候选人皮特·赫格塞斯因性侵指控支付和解金 “`

(SeaPRwire) - 华盛顿——据贺赛思的律师说,当选总统的国防部长人选皮特·贺赛思向一名指控他性侵的女子支付了款项,以避免一场毫无根据的诉讼的威胁。 据一份报告称,贺赛思在2017年一次在加利福尼亚州蒙特雷举行的共和党妇女活动的演讲后被指控性侵犯。没有提出任何指控。 他的律师蒂莫西·帕拉托雷周日告诉美联社,性行为是双方自愿的,几天后向警方报案的女子是“施暴者”。这一说法尚未在市政府发布的声明中得到证实。 帕拉托雷表示,在警方调查几年后,作为一项秘密和解协议的一部分,向该女子支付了一笔款项,因为贺赛思担心她准备提起诉讼,他担心这可能会导致他被福克斯新闻(Fox News)解雇,而他在那里是一位受欢迎的主持人。帕拉托雷没有透露支付的金额。 “他被错误地指控,我的立场是他性侵案的受害者,”帕拉托雷说,称这是一个“成功的敲诈勒索”案件。 《华盛顿邮报》早些时候详细报道了这笔款项。该报还报道称,它获得了一份备忘录副本,该备忘录本周发送给特朗普的过渡团队,一位自称是原告朋友的女子在备忘录中详细描述了性侵指控。 特朗普的过渡团队周日没有立即对这份备忘录发表评论。 据该市声明,举报性侵的人——其姓名、年龄和性别未被公布——右大腿有瘀伤。该人士告诉警方,事件中没有使用武器。 据该市声明,事件发生在10月7日晚上11:59到第二天早上7点之间。 据当时的社交媒体帖子和宣传材料显示,贺赛思当时在蒙特雷参加加利福尼亚州共和党妇女联合会在其两年一度的会议上举行的宴会晚宴。 蒙特雷官员表示,他们将隐瞒警方报告中包含的进一步细节,因为这些细节包括执法官员的分析和结论,根据州公共记录法,这些内容免于公开。 在2017年的指控发生时,现年44岁的贺赛思正与他的第二任妻子离婚,他们育有三个孩子。据法庭记录和贺赛思的社交媒体帖子显示,在他与一位现任妻子(福克斯新闻制作人)生下一个孩子后,他的第二任妻子提出了离婚申请。据法庭记录显示,他的第一次婚姻在2009年结束,原因也是贺赛思的不忠。 在上周指控首次浮出水面后,特朗普过渡团队发言人、被任命为白宫通讯主任的史蒂文·张发表声明称,当选总统正在“提名高素质且极具资格的候选人来担任其政府的职务”。 “贺赛思先生强烈否认任何及所有指控,并且没有提出任何指控。我们期待他获得美国国防部长职位的确认,以便他能够从第一天开始就让美国安全和再次伟大,”张说。 ——美联社记者威尔·魏斯塞特在佛罗里达州棕榈滩对此报道做出了贡献。本文由第三方内容提供商提供。SeaPRwire (https://www.seaprwire.com/)对此不作任何保证或陈述。 分类: 头条新闻,日常新闻 SeaPRwire为公司和机构提供全球新闻稿发布,覆盖超过6,500个媒体库、86,000名编辑和记者,以及350万以上终端桌面和手机App。SeaPRwire支持英、日、德、韩、法、俄、印尼、马来、越南、中文等多种语言新闻稿发布。

拜登授权乌克兰使用美国提供的远程导弹打击俄罗斯 “`

(SeaPRwire) - 巴西马瑙斯——据一位美国官员和另外三位知情人士透露,美国总统乔·拜登已授权乌克兰使用美国提供的远程导弹打击俄罗斯境内更深的目标,放松了对这些武器的限制,此前俄罗斯部署了数千名朝鲜军队以加强其战争。 允许基辅使用陆军战术导弹系统(ATACMs)对俄罗斯境内更深处发动袭击的决定,正值俄罗斯总统弗拉基米尔·普京将朝鲜军队部署在乌克兰北部边境,试图收复乌克兰军队夺取的数百英里领土之际。 拜登的举动也紧随唐纳德·特朗普总统大选获胜之后,特朗普曾表示他会迅速结束战争,并对他的政府是否会继续美国对乌克兰至关重要的军事支持表示不确定。 这位官员和其他了解此事的人未被授权公开讨论美国的决定,并要求匿名。 乌克兰总统泽连斯基周日的反应相当克制。 他在夜间视频讲话中说:“袭击不是用言语进行的。”“这种事情不会被宣布。导弹会自己说话。” 泽连斯基和他的许多西方支持者数月来一直在向拜登施压,要求允许乌克兰使用西方提供的导弹打击俄罗斯境内更深的军事目标,称美国的禁令使乌克兰无法阻止俄罗斯对其城市和电网的袭击。 泽连斯基的声明是在他在Telegram上发布慰问信息之后不久发表的,此前俄罗斯对一座九层建筑的袭击造成北部城市苏梅至少8人死亡,苏梅距离俄罗斯边境40公里(24英里)。 俄罗斯还发动了大规模的无人机和导弹袭击,官员称这是最近几个月规模最大的一次袭击,目标是能源基础设施,并造成平民伤亡。此次袭击之际,人们越来越担心莫斯科在冬季来临之前摧毁乌克兰发电能力的意图。 泽连斯基说:“这就是对所有试图通过谈判、电话、拥抱和安抚来与普京达成某种目的的人的回应。” 这番评论似乎是在影射德国总理奥拉夫·朔尔茨,后者周五与普京进行了通话,这是近两年来一位主要西方大国领导人与普京进行的首次此类通话。 一些支持者认为,这种限制以及其他美国的限制可能会让乌克兰输掉战争。这场辩论已成为乌克兰北约盟友之间分歧的根源。 拜登一直持反对态度,决心坚守防线,反对任何他认为可能导致美国和其他北约成员国与拥有核武器的俄罗斯直接冲突的升级。 普京警告说,如果北约盟国允许乌克兰使用他们的武器攻击俄罗斯领土,莫斯科可能会向其他人提供远程武器来打击西方目标。 拜登的决定是在过去两天与韩国、日本和中国领导人举行会谈之后传出的。朝鲜军队的增援是会谈的核心内容,这些会谈是在秘鲁亚太经济合作峰会期间举行的。 拜登在前往二十国集团峰会途中,在巴西亚马逊雨林的一次讲话中没有提及这一决定。 当被问及这一决定时,联合国秘书长安东尼奥·古特雷斯告诉记者,联合国的立场是“避免乌克兰战争持续恶化”。 古特雷斯周日在里约热内卢峰会之前说:“我们希望和平,我们希望公平的和平。”他没有详细说明。 据一位知情人士透露,远程导弹可能会用于回应朝鲜决定支持普京入侵乌克兰。 ATACMs导弹的整体供应短缺,因此美国官员过去曾质疑他们能否向乌克兰提供足够的导弹以产生影响。一些乌克兰的支持者表示,即使是对俄罗斯境内更深处进行几次远程袭击,也会迫使俄罗斯军队改变部署,并消耗更多资源。 朝鲜向俄罗斯提供了数千名士兵,以帮助莫斯科试图夺回乌克兰今年夺取的库尔斯克边境地区。朝鲜军队加入冲突之际,莫斯科的局势出现了有利的变化。特朗普暗示,他可能会促使乌克兰同意放弃俄罗斯占领的一些土地,以结束冲突。 据美国、韩国和乌克兰的评估,多达1.2万名朝鲜士兵被派往俄罗斯。美国和韩国情报官员表示,朝鲜还向俄罗斯提供了大量的弹药,以补充其日益减少的武器储备。 特朗普在竞选期间数月来一直谈到希望俄罗斯在乌克兰的战争结束,但他大多回避了有关他是否希望美国盟友乌克兰获胜的问题。 他还反复抨击拜登政府向基辅提供了数十亿美元的援助。他的胜利让乌克兰的国际支持者担心,任何仓促的和解都将主要有利于普京。 自2022年2月俄罗斯军队入侵以来,美国是乌克兰在战争中最有价值的盟友,提供了超过562亿美元的安全援助。 然而,由于担心俄罗斯的反应,拜登政府一再推迟提供乌克兰寻求的一些特定先进武器,只是在基辅、其支持者和盟友的压力下才同意提供。 这包括最初拒绝泽连斯基对先进坦克、爱国者防空系统和F-16战斗机的请求,以及其他系统。 白宫5月份同意允许乌克兰使用美国提供的武器对俄罗斯边境附近地区进行有限的打击。 ——Long、Miller、Knickmeyer和Lee从华盛顿报道。美联社记者Will Weissert(佛罗里达州西棕榈滩)和Hanna Arhirova(基辅)对本报告做出了贡献。本文由第三方内容提供商提供。SeaPRwire (https://www.seaprwire.com/)对此不作任何保证或陈述。 分类: 头条新闻,日常新闻 SeaPRwire为公司和机构提供全球新闻稿发布,覆盖超过6,500个媒体库、86,000名编辑和记者,以及350万以上终端桌面和手机App。SeaPRwire支持英、日、德、韩、法、俄、印尼、马来、越南、中文等多种语言新闻稿发布。 ```
